When something important happens in Airtable, we let you know through notifications. The events that are currently able to trigger notifications include when someone shares a base with you, adds you to a workspace, @mentions you in a record, or assigns you to a record using a collaborator field. These alerts are delivered through email, mobile push notifications, and the bell-shaped notification icon in the app.

To change your notification settings, click on the account icon in the top right corner to bring up the Account menu, then click on the Notification preferences option.
This will allow you to switch mobile push notifications and email notifications on or off.

Can I choose specific types of notifications to receive?
At this time it isn't possible to only receive notifications for one particular event, like being mentioned in a record comment.
